Atlas Moose is approximately 5 months old and weighs around 42 lbs. We believe he may be a German Shepherd/Bloodhound mix, though with rescue, breed and age are always a mystery. Between those giant ears, his impressive nose, and the way he sniffs out food, we'd bet there's some hound mixed in there! He's essentially built like a baby moose and is still growing, so we don't expect him to stay small. Atlas is sweet, loving, curious, playful, and always ready for a good time. He loves toys, especially balls, and has already mastered the game of fetch! His food motivation will make him a joy to train, as he's eager to learn and shows lots of potential.
Ideal Home
Atlas would do best in a home with a backyard where he has room to run, play fetch, and burn off energy. He's going to need a family committed to training and socialization, as he's a large breed puppy with typical puppy energy. He could do well as an only dog or with another medium to large dog that enjoys playful puppy energy.

Training & Support
Atlas is working on crate training and potty training and is doing great! Like any puppy his age, he'll need continued consistency, routine, and structure as he grows. He's eager to learn and will thrive with continued training and socialization.
